Using sensors to detect current or voltage of motors is disadvantaged because motor is exposed to vibration, impacts, corrosion, high temperature and humidity in the machinery structure like HEV. In the case of IPMSM, position information is included not only in the flux or EMF term but also in the rotator inductance because of its saliency.
